dc.description.abstractBorrowers’ progress in paying their federal student loans is considered a proxy for the quality and value of a higher education institution. Historically, however, efforts to report student loan repayment progress have not focused on graduate and professional degrees. A new data set allows the authors to examine the progress of graduate students from each higher education institution in paying down federal student loans between 2009 and 2014.en
